Bouteflika reiterates Algeria’s readiness to continue building on its partnership with France

July 15, 2016 at 2:02 pm

Algerian President Abdelaziz Bouteflika, renewed his country’s readiness to continue to build an exceptional partnership with France. He expressed his satisfaction with the intense, ongoing political dialogue between the two countries.

This came in a greeting message sent by Bouteflika to the French President Francois Hollande on the occasion of the National Day of France yesterday.

In his message, Bouteflika stressed on the excellent friendship and cooperation between the two countries who share lots of mutual values and common interests, expressing his desire to continue to build on this partnership.

The Algerian president expressed his satisfaction with the intensity of the on-going political dialogue between the two countries.

“This promising dialogue is marked with our commitment to wisely address all the issues in a spirit of mutual trust and understanding, to promote convergence of positions and approaches to the major issues of our time,” Bouteflika said.

He stressed that this will enhance the partnership between Algeria and France.

Bouteflika also renewed Algeria’s willingness to further enhance its cooperation with France in fighting cross-border terrorism and violent extremism, as well as in efforts that aim to achieve cultural objectives in the area of peace, security and development, according to a new course of international relations that adequately meet the peoples’ aspirations.
